Default Lecturer English WAPDA PTS

Today i took an exam for the said post,sharing whatever i remember with right answers for everyone.

MCQ's: 100
Duration: 2 hrs
Book colour: YELLOW

1. Jane Eyre is written by: Charlotte Brontė
2. Birth place of Jane Austin: Hampshire
3. Total soliloquies in Hamlet: seven
4. Original name of Pride and Prejudice: First Impressions
5. Death of Ophelia in Hamlet was caused by: drowning
6. Opening line in Twelfth Night is spoken by: duke
7. Giving human attribute is: personification
8. How many lines in a sonnet: 14
9. Comparison using as or like: simile
10. Comparison without using as or like: metaphor
11. London, 1802 is written in form: Petrarchan Sonnet
12. Rare thing Solitary Reaper: ???
13. Pathetic Fallacy term was coined by: John Ruskin
14. Peasant Poet was: John Clare
15. Who taught Gulliver Lilliputian language: Six scholars are employed to teach him
16. Which of the following is not one of the reasons Gulliver is convicted of treason in Lilliput: He ate too much, causing a famine
17. What is Gulliver's role on his first voyage: Surgeon
18. Where were three friends were going to in The Rime of Ancient Mariner:A wedding
19. There's a special providence in the fall of a sparrow. This line is from: Hamlet
20. A tale of two cities first published in: 1859
21: Before poet keats was a: Surgeon
22. morning star of renaissance: Chaucer
23. what is in the opening scene of Hamlet: Marcellus and Horatio come into the scene
24. Which disease hamlet have: schizophrenia
